Real-time Detection of ctDNA and/or HPV DNA in High-risk Locally-advanced Head and Neck Squamous Cell Carcinoma
Sponsor: University Health Network, Toronto
Summary
This research study will include patients with high risk locally advanced head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(LA-HNSCC) of the oral cavity, oropharynx, hypopharynx or larynx and patients that are starting on standard definitive treatment. Patients with both stage III HPV positive and stage III HPV negative will be included. In this study, we aim to evaluate feasibility of ctDNA and/or HPV DNA detection in real time in high-risk LA-HNSCC.
Official title: Real-time Detection of ctDNA and/or HPV DNA in High-risk Locally-advanced Head and Neck Squamous Cell Carcinoma (LA-HNSCC): The Pre-MERIDIAN (Molecular Residual Disease Interception in High-risk LA-HNSCC) Study.
